Where does “shallows” come from?
Shallows comes from Middle English schalowe, a word of uncertain origin and meaning.

Ancestry of “shallows”, step by step
| Step | Language | Word | Meaning |
|---|
| 1 | English | shallow | Having little depth; significantly less deep than... |
| 2 | Middle English | schalowe | not deep, shallow |
| 3 | Proto-Germanic | *skal- | — |
| 4 | Proto-Indo-European | (s)kelh₁- | to parch, wither |
